Moderately bullish activity in MicroStrategy (MSTR), with shares up $1.47, or 1.17%, near $127.50. Options volume relatively light with 172k contracts traded and calls leading puts for a put/call ratio of 0.98, compared to a typical level near 0.79. Implied volatility (IV30) is higher by 1.1 points near 75.46,in the top quartile of the past year, suggesting an expected daily move of $6.06. Put-call skew steepened, indicating increased demand for downside protection.
